Por qué es importante

You run a site that has grown over years, and every redesign creates anxiety because old links are scattered across search results, docs, blog posts, emails, and partner content. Redirects help at first, but after multiple platform changes the rules become messy and nobody knows what still works. You end up doing manual checks, chasing SEO issues, and dealing with customers who land on generic pages instead of the content they needed. Existing CMS features solve simple renames, not long-term continuity. What you need is a system that treats URLs as an asset, remembers what existed before, and blocks launches that quietly break trust.

Alcance del MVP · 1-2 semanas

Semana 1
  • Build a crawler that imports URLs from sitemap.xml and CSV exports
  • Store URL status, canonical destination, and redirect chain in PostgreSQL
  • Create a rule engine that flags 404s, loops, and chains longer than 3 hops
  • Ship a basic dashboard listing failing URLs by severity
  • Add email report generation for daily or one-off scans
Semana 2
  • Add snapshot comparison so users can test current results against a prior crawl
  • Build a GitHub Action that fails a deployment on critical URL regressions
  • Create a redirect suggestion module based on slug similarity and path patterns
  • Add Slack alerts and CSV export for engineering handoff
  • Launch a landing page with migration audit signup and Stripe billing

Por qué esto podría fallar

Autorrefutación: la señal de confianza más importante

  1. 1Teams may only feel the pain during migrations, making retention difficult unless ongoing governance value is obvious.
  2. 2Internal SEO agencies and devops scripts may already cover enough of the problem for larger customers.
  3. 3If scans produce too many false alarms from rate limits, geoblocking, or anti-bot tools, users will stop trusting the product.
